Please include the parking lot interior landscaping calculation on the Landscape Plan. a. Please note that the parking lot interior landscaping is 8% of the total area used for parking, loading, driveways, internal drive aisles, and other vehicular use areas. i. Please include the dimensions of each landscaping island and note that one tree is required for every 144 square feet of the total interior landscaped area, with a minimum of one tree per island per Table 5.4.6.D of the UDO. ii. Each landscaping island must be a minimum of 12 feet measured from back of curb to back of curb. iii. If needed to meet the 8% landscaping requirement, the Dwarf Yaupon Hollys adjacent the 50’ parking setback may be credited. 10. Please include the streetyard landscaping calculations on the Landscape Plan. Please note that the streetyard landscaping standards can be found in Table 5.4.7.B of the UDO. a. The minimum required area along Market Street is 25 square feet for every linear foot of street yard frontage, with a minimum width of 12.5’ and maximum width of 37.5’. Existing vegetation may apply towards this standard and will be reviewed once existing vegetation is added to the plans. b. For every 600 square feet of street yard area, a minimum of one, 3-inch caliper canopy/shade tree, and six shrubs, 12 inches in height at the time of planting, are required. Since overhead power lines are located in this area, 3 Crepe Myrtles for every canopy tree can be planted instead. 7650/7656 Market Street – Commercial Site Plan – Conceptual Review Page | 3 i. In order to reduce the SHOD setbacks, an additional tree must be planted in the streetyard for every 40’ road frontage per Section 3.5.3.D.c of the UDO. 11. Please include the foundation planting calculations on the Landscape Plan. a. The foundation planting area is calculated using the area of the building face multiplied by 12%. b. Please note that foundation planting areas are required between the building face and the parking lot/drive aisles per Section 5.4.8 of the UDO. 12.
